System hangs while changing ip address

 
Saravanan_15
Advisor

System hangs while changing ip address

Hi Experts,
I have a hp rx2600 server running hp-ux11.23. My problem is ,if i change the ip address from the CDE login, my system got hung. I have to hard reset the server. After reboot, sometimes the changed ip becomes active, sometime it remains old ip even after reboot...Why it so?.. Any idea???

rick jones
Honored Contributor

Re: System hangs while changing ip address

If you change the IP address of the machine, and do not have the old IP address any longer, any existing connections to that IP address (even if they are only on the machine itself) will fail. That failure will take as long as 10 minutes or even more to become noticed by the applications (if they rely on stack timeouts) and could very easily appear as a "hang"

You also need to make sure that the new IP will resolve in the DNS and/or /etc/hosts files

This is why if you want to change the primary IP of a system it is best to use set_parms and to allow the system to reboot.
